Step-by-Step Guide to Drawing Calvin
Now that you have your materials ready, let’s break down the process of drawing Calvin into manageable steps.
Step 1: Sketch the Basic Shapes
Start by lightly sketching the basic shapes that make up Calvin’s body. Use circles and ovals to outline his head, torso, and limbs:
- Draw a circle for the head.
- Add an oval for the body beneath the head.
- Sketch guidelines for the arms and legs.
Step 2: Define the Face
Once you have the basic shapes, focus on Calvin’s face:
- Draw two large, expressive eyes within the head circle.
- Add a small nose and a wide, cheeky grin.
- Don’t forget to add his spiky hair at the top of the head.
Step 3: Add Details to the Body
Next, refine the body shape:
- Draw the outline of his red and black striped shirt, making sure it fits snugly.
- Add the arms and legs, ensuring that they appear playful and animated.
Step 4: Finalize the Drawing
With the basic sketch in place, it’s time to go over your lines:
- Use a fine-tip black marker or ink pen to outline Calvin’s features.
- Erase any unnecessary pencil lines after the ink dries.
Step 5: Color Your Drawing
If you wish to add color, use colored pencils or markers:
- Color Calvin’s shirt red with black stripes.
- Use light skin tones for his face and limbs.
Step-by-Step Guide to Drawing Hobbes
Now that you’ve mastered Calvin, it’s time to draw Hobbes.
Step 1: Basic Shapes
Similar to Calvin, start with basic shapes:
- Draw a round shape for Hobbes’ head.
- Add an oval for the body beneath the head.
Step 2: Define the Face
Focus on Hobbes’ facial features:
- Draw large, round eyes with a playful expression.
- Add a triangular nose and a big smile.
- Sketch his ears and the distinctive stripes on his head.
Step 3: Outline the Body
Refine the shape of Hobbes’ body:
- Sketch the outline of his furry body, ensuring it appears cuddly and friendly.
- Draw his arms and legs, giving them a playful and relaxed position.
Step 4: Finalize the Drawing
Similar to Calvin, finalize Hobbes’ drawing:
- Use a fine-tip marker to outline Hobbes.
- Erase any unnecessary pencil lines.
Step 5: Add Color
Color Hobbes with the following tips:
- Use orange for his body and white for his underbelly.
- Add black stripes along his back and face.
